Insurance broking and risk management services<br />

Local Government Insurance Service (LGIS) works together<br />

with the City of Wanneroo to provide a unique and tailored<br />

suite of insurance and risk management services. The<br />

Scheme, incorporating the LGIS WorkCare, Liability and<br />

Property funds, provides a pooled fund and mutual scheme<br />

with other WA local governments, for City of Wanneroo to<br />

take control of their risk and minimise costs, as an alternative<br />

to traditional insurance. This is achieved by taking a<br />

coordinated approach to risk management,<br />

claims management and injury management that is<br />

holistic and seamless.<br />

The contribution paid by the City of Wanneroo is required<br />

to fund the actual and potential cost of risk exposures. The<br />

positive claims performance over recent years has resulted in<br />

an annual dividend disbursement to the City.<br />

Insurance premiums<br />

General insurance premiums (excluding workers<br />

compensation) in <strong>2014</strong>/<strong>15</strong> decreased by approximately<br />

4.5% due to improvements in motor vehicle claims and<br />

an aggressive marketing campaign by Local Government<br />

Insurance Services where rate/premium reductions were<br />

achieved.<br />

The City continues to strive to achieve competitive premiums<br />

and comprehensive coverage for our insurable risks.<br />

AUDIT AND RISK COMMITTEE<br />

The primary objectives of the audit and risk committee are:<br />

• Liaise with the local government’s internal and external<br />

auditors so that Council can be satisfied with the<br />

performance of the local government in managing its<br />

affairs.<br />

• The committee also advises the City in the management<br />

of business enterprise risks, to review the strategic risk<br />

register and provide advice to management on high<br />

risk issues.<br />

This committee is represented by the Mayor and all<br />

Councillors. Councillor Nguyen was the chairperson and<br />

Councillor Zappa the deputy chairperson. The Committee<br />

met on the following dates during <strong>2014</strong>/<strong>15</strong>:<br />
